Ingredients
– 4 boneless chicken thighs or chops
– 2 tablespoons honey
– 2 tablespoons Dijon mustard
– 1 teaspoon garlic powder
– 1 teaspoon paprika
– 4 medium-sized potatoes, diced
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– 1 cup chicken broth
– Fresh parsley, for garnish (optional)
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ating Honey Mustard Chicken Chops and Potato Skillet is an enjoyable experience when you follow these simple steps:
1. Prepare the Chicken: In a small bowl, combine honey, Dijon mustard,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per. Mix well to create the marinade.
2. Marinate the Chicken: Coat the chicken chops with the marinade, ensuring they are well covered. Allow it to sit for about 10 minutes while you prepare the potatoes.
3. Cook the Potatoes: In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add the diced potatoes and season them with salt and pepper. Cook for about 10-15 minutes or until they are starting to soften.
4. Add Chicken: Push the potatoes to the side of the skillet and add the marinated chicken. Cook the chicken for 5-7 minutes on each side or until it re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).
5. Combine Ingredients: Once the chicken is browned, combine it with the potatoes in the skillet. Pour in the chicken broth and let everything simmer for another 5-10 minutes. This will help meld the flavors together beautifully.
6. Taste and Adjust: Check the seasoning and adjust with additional salt or pepper if needed. The broth should have thickened slightly, creating a lovely sauce.
7. Garnish and Serve: Once everything is cooked, remove from heat. Garnish with fresh parsley for an elegant touch.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Herbs: Fresh parsley or thyme can enhance the flavors of the dish. Add them during the final minutes of cooking for a burst of freshness.
– Make it Spicy: If you enjoy a kick, consider adding a pinch of red pepper flakes or a dash of hot sauce to the marinade.
– Customize Potatoes: Feel free to substitute the potatoes for sweet potatoes or even cauliflower for a healthier twist.
– Serve with Bread: A crusty bread can be a lovely side to soak up any extra sauce left in the skillet.
Recipe Variation
Experiment with different flavors by trying out these ideas:
1. Honey Mustard Glaze: Instead of marinading the chicken, brush the honey mustard mixture on the chicken right before serving for a fresh glaze.
2. Herb Infusion: Incorporate fresh herbs like rosemary or thyme in the cooking process for added depth in flavor.
3. Add Vegetables: Toss in seasonal vegetables such as bell peppers or green beans during the cooking process for extra color and nutrition.
4. Citrus Twist: Add some lemon or orange zest to the marinade for a refreshing citrus flavor that pairs well with honey.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ator. This dish can be kept fresh for up to 3 days.
– Freezing: You can freeze the Honey Mustard Chicken Chops and Potato Skillet in a sealed container. It will stay good for about 2-3 months. To reheat, allow it to thaw overnight in the refrigerator before warming it on the stovetop over low heat.

Frequently Asked Questions
→ Can I use chicken breasts instead of thighs?
Yes! Chicken breasts can be used, but they may cook faster, so keep an eye on their temperature.
→ What if I don’t have Dijon mustard?
You can substitute it with yellow mustard or even honey mustard for a sweeter flavor.
→ Can I double the recipe?
Absolutely! Just ensure your skillet is large enough to accommodate the increased volume or use two skillets.
→ Is this dish gluten-free?
Yes, this recipe is naturally gluten-free as long as you use gluten-free chicken broth.
→ How can I make this dish dairy-free?
This recipe is already dairy-free, making it suitable for lactose-intolerant diets.
